Doole's climate, with its high heat and low humidity, can cause certain flooring materials to shrink, crack, or warp. We highly recommend materials like ceramic or porcelain tile, which handle temperature extremes well, or engineered hardwood that is more dimensionally stable than solid hardwood. For luxury vinyl plank (LVP), ensure it has a high-quality wear layer to resist sun fading from our intense Texas sun.
For a standard-sized room, most installations take 1-3 days, but this depends heavily on material preparation and subfloor condition. In Doole, where many homes are on slab foundations, extra time may be needed for moisture testing and leveling. Scheduling is also seasonal; late spring and early fall are peak times, so booking several weeks in advance is wise to secure your preferred dates.
Generally, simple flooring replacement in an existing home does not require a permit in Doole or Brown County. However, if your project involves structural changes to the subfloor or is part of a larger remodel that alters the home's footprint, you should check with the Brown County Building Department. Always ensure your installer carries proper Texas-licensed liability insurance.

Despite the arid climate, concrete slab foundations common in Doole can wick moisture from the soil, especially if there has been recent irrigation or a rare heavy rain. This residual moisture can ruin adhesive installations like vinyl or laminate, causing mold and buckling. A professional installer will perform a concrete moisture test before installation—this is a critical, non-negotiable step for long-lasting results in our region.
